The cheapest way to get from Figueres to Aragon is to drive which costs €60 - €90 and takes 4h 3m.
The fastest way to get from Figueres to Aragon is to train which takes 2h 55m and costs €55 - €120.
No, there is no direct train from Figueres to Aragon. However, there are services departing from Figueres Vilafant and arriving at Zaragoza-Delicias via . The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 2h 55m.
The distance between Figueres and Aragon is 438 km. The road distance is 382.6 km.
The best way to get from Figueres to Aragon without a car is to train which takes 2h 55m and costs €55 - €120.
It takes approximately 2h 55m to get from Figueres to Aragon, including transfers.
Figueres to Aragon train services, operated by Renfe AVE, depart from Figueres Vilafant station.
Figueres to Aragon train services, operated by Renfe AVE, arrive at Zaragoza-Delicias station.
Yes, the driving distance between Figueres to Aragon is 383 km. It takes approximately 4h 3m to drive from Figueres to Aragon.

What companies run services between Figueres, Spain and Aragon, Spain?
Renfe AVE operates a train from Figueres Vilafant to Zaragoza-Delicias every 4 hours. Tickets cost €65–120 and the journey takes 2h 33m. Renfe Viajeros also services this route twice daily.
